Prexol 0.25mg Tablet is a Parkinson's disease and restless leg syndrome medicine (an urge to move the legs usually accompanied or caused by uncomfortable and unpleasant leg sensations). Slowing down body motions helps to alleviate excessive shaking.
Prexol 0.25mg Tablet should be taken after food. Take it at the same time every day, though, to ensure a steady dose of medicine in your body. Take this drug in the dose and for the duration of time prescribed by your doctor, and if you miss a dose, take it as soon as you remember. Even if you feel better, you should never skip a dose and complete the entire course of treatment. This drug should not be abruptly stopped without first seeing your doctor.

Directions for Use of Prexol 0.25 MG Tablet 10
Follow your doctor's instructions on the dosage and duration of Prexol Tablet. Take it all in at once. It should not be chewed, crushed, or broken. Prexol 0.25mg Tablet should be taken after a meal.
Side Effects of Prexol 0.25 MG Tablet 10
The majority of side effects are minor and will go away as your body adjusts to the medicine. If they don't go away or you're concerned about them, see your doctor. Adverse Effects of Prexol Tablet Dizziness, Sleepiness, Nausea, Dryness in mouth, Fatigue, Hallucination.
How Prexol 0.25 MG Tablet 10 Works?
Prexol 0.25mg Tablet works by enhancing the activity of dopamine, a chemical messenger required for brain movement control.
